当前位置: 首页 > news >正文

景德镇市网站建设_网站建设公司_在线商城_seo优化

石家庄seo网站建设,昆明网站建设排名,做网站建设怎么找客户,新沂网页设计在进行Python爬虫任务时#xff0c;经常会遇到连接超时#xff08;TimeoutError#xff09;错误。连接超时意味着爬虫无法在规定的时间内建立与目标服务器的连接#xff0c;导致请求失败。为了帮助您解决这个常见的问题#xff0c;本文将提供一些解决办法#xff0c;并提…在进行Python爬虫任务时经常会遇到连接超时TimeoutError错误。连接超时意味着爬虫无法在规定的时间内建立与目标服务器的连接导致请求失败。为了帮助您解决这个常见的问题本文将提供一些解决办法并提供相关的代码示例希望能为您的爬虫任务提供实战价值。 一、了解连接超时错误 连接超时错误是指爬虫在连接目标服务器时由于网络延迟、服务器繁忙等原因无法在指定的时间内建立连接。这可能导致数据获取失败和爬虫任务无法正常进行。 二、解决办法 以下是几种常见的解决办法您可以根据实际情况选择适合您的方法 1. 增加超时时间 通过增加超时时间可以解决因网络延迟而导致的连接超时错误。可以通过设置适当的超时时间确保爬虫有足够的时间与服务器建立连接和获取数据。 在这个例子中我们使用requests库发送GET请求并设置了10秒的超时时间。可以根据实际情况进行调整。 2. 重试机制 如果连接超时错误是偶发性的可以使用重试机制在遇到连接超时错误后重新发送请求直到成功或达到最大重试次数为止。 在这个例子中我们使用了requests库和urllib3库来实现重试机制。通过设置重试次数和重试间隔可以在遇到连接超时错误时自动重新发送请求。 3. 更换网络环境 连接超时错误可能是由于网络问题导致的例如代理服务器不稳定、局域网限制等。在遇到连接超时错误时您可以尝试更换网络环境例如切换到其他网络或使用代理服务并重新发送请求。 4. 优化代码逻辑 有时候在代码逻辑上的优化也可以减少连接超时错误的发生。例如合理使用多线程或异步请求减少请求的负荷提高爬虫的效率。 三、总结 通过增加超时时间、使用重试机制、更换网络环境或优化代码逻辑您可以有效解决Python爬虫中遇到的连接超时错误。请注意上述的代码示例仅为示范实际使用时请根据您的具体需求和爬虫框架进行相应的调整。 希望本文提供的解决办法能有效帮助您解决连接超时错误并使您的爬虫任务顺利进行。如果您需要更多帮助或有任何问题欢迎评论区留言我们将竭诚为您解答。
http://www.ihoyoo.com/news/48565.html

相关文章:

  • 合肥网站建设模板系统国内crm系统哪家好
  • 网站图片素材下载工程建设公司起名大全集免费
  • 寿县城乡建设局网站wordpress关闭自适应
  • 麦包包网站建设特点学校资源网站建设
  • 陆丰网页设计网站建设和优化
  • 1.网站开发的详细流程简单免费的制图软件
  • 建设网站要不要工商执照东莞市电商网站建设
  • 企业型网站建设包括北京市建筑工程设计有限责任公司
  • 网站制作公司南宁专业做网站 上海
  • 百度做网站需要多少钱静海集团网站建设
  • 东莞php网站开发网站推广网站
  • 商洛高新建设开发集团网站深圳招聘网站排行
  • 在线ps网站wordpress模板无法显示
  • 网站建设龙卡要审批多久时间wordpress整合ckplay
  • 网页设计素材网站推荐天津通用网站建设收费
  • 宣城市建设银行网站如何设计一个网页里面有很多小工具
  • 公司企业做网站网站建设进度以及具体内容
  • 房产网站开发方案神农架网站建设
  • 巴中移动网站建设做公司网站利润
  • 网站的服务器电子商务网站按其实现的技术可分为
  • 游戏开奖网站建设黔东网站建设
  • 网站里的轮廓图 怎么做的wordpress有什么选什么用
  • 做一个京东网站怎么做的引流软件
  • 银川公司做网站威海网站开发公司电话
  • 做直播网站软件有哪些趣图在线生成网站源码
  • 网站制作公司兴田德润实力强超级ppt市场免费模板
  • 做的网站打开显示无标题dedecms 调用网站名称
  • 重庆制作网站西南大学校园网站建设往年考试卷
  • 网站大全免黄公司名注册查询
  • 开发一个商城网站多少钱昆明网站建设公司排行